The San Diego Unified School District board of education voted unanimously Tuesday night time to implement the first phase of a four-year, $12.2 million plan to shift its fifty four year-round colleges to traditional academic calendars. Instead of the standard September through June schedule, with a two-month summer season break, kids in year-round faculties are placed on one of 4 tracks. They go to highschool 60 days and take 20 off, which implies that at any given time, one-fourth of the scholars are out of college.

The preliminary moves are expected to value the district round $3 million. The district plans to transition extra schools to conventional calendars in every of the following three years. SAN DIEGO – The San Diego Unified School District Board of Education voted unanimously this week to implement the first section of a four-year $12.2 million plan to shift its 54 year-round faculties to traditional educational calendars. In most eventualities, lecturers make the identical amount of money of their districts whether they work at a year-round or traditional school, though the pay schedules may differ. Teachers who made extra money teaching summer time school still have that choice in year-round districts that supply remedial courses throughout break periods. The largest economic impression for teachers who transfer to year-round schedules is if they're accustomed to taking on part-time work during the summers. Depending on the kind of work, this could imply a lack of a number of thousand dollars yearly.

For mother and father with youngsters of different ages and in several faculties, a year-round schedule might present severe scheduling points. This argument assumes that colleges would actually adhere to totally different time-off schedules—something that seemingly could probably be adjusted so that each one schools within a specific district or geographic area have been on the identical schedule. It may be difficult for working parents to search out babysitters for one or two weeks at a time every few months, as opposed to three months straight in the summertime. Child-care centers and camps would probably have the ability to offer programs when students needed them. Just because those programs aren't available now does not mean they'd not exist if the school schedules shifted.

In this article, we explored how students’ experiences could be enhanced by implementing a year-round education system. Year-round schools can supply college students extra engagement, extra studying time, and shorter downtime throughout which studying could also be misplaced. Year-round applications can be particularly beneficial for low-income and minority youngsters, who have been statistically proven to suffer most from long school breaks. Students who need more time to learn could benefit from extra assist academics are able to present when increased school time permits them to take action. Increasing the time spent in class would bring the us training system more consistent with other developed international locations, serving to our children to be higher prepared to compete in a worldwide group.
